## Wiki RBAC — Contractor Setup

Our Greywall wiki uses three roles: reader, editor, and steward. Contractors start as editors on assigned spaces only; stewards approve any scope expansion, and all role changes are logged for quarterly audit. Before you can sync pages from the staging mirror, the sync tool must authenticate to the internal roles service using the key below.

API key for yahig-tadup: kto7_ubizbYm

Hey Priya — handing over the log-sampling work on Chattermill before I'm out next week. The service was flooding Logview, so I dialed sampling down to 5% on info-level and kept errors at 100%. Config lives in the sampler-rules repo; the release manager just needs to sign off on the next deploy. One gotcha: if the sampler config store rejects your session during rollout, it falls back to locked mode. To unlock it you'll need the recovery passphrase, which is recorded directly below this note.

vault phrase of tajop-haduf = holath-brivan-wenax

Cut-over done Tuesday 02:00. Old Scrollkeeper viewer is read-only until the 30th, then decommissioned. Auditglass now serves all audit-log queries; backfill of the trailing 90 days finished with zero checksum mismatches. Two issues: export CSV timed out for one tenant (fixed, raised worker limit), and timezone display defaulted to UTC (intentional, documented). Query latency p95 down 40%. Dashboards updated; alerts rerouted to the Nightbell rotation. Post-cut-over, the service is running with these configuration values.

settings of tagef-bawif:
DRUIX_HOST=druix.zemvarlabs.internal
DRUIX_PORT=8000